Poulsen suffers adductor injury

The Dane only played a few minutes against VfB Stuttgart before being forced off the pitch with an injury. It remains to be seen what this means for RB's trip to Brazil.

Yussuf Poulsen suffered a minor muscle injury in the adductor area during RB Leipzig's 3-2 defeat against VfB Stuttgart in the final Bundesliga game of the season. This was announced by the club. The Dane had been substituted against VfB in the 66th minute and had to be replaced by Benjamin Sesko in the 87th minute.

What the striker's latest injury means for the club's upcoming trip to Brazil remains to be seen. RB will fly to South America from May 23 to 30. In addition to activities in and around Sao Paulo and training sessions at the training center of sister club Red Bull Bragantino, a test match against FC Santos is also planned.
